4031 Pacific Highway San Diego, CA
(619) 738-0151

Find What You're Looking For

Group Classes, Nutrition, Personal Training, Corrective Exercise, and More!


We offer group CrossFit classes for athletes at all levels. Whether you're a serious athlete or casual exerciser, as long as you've completed the on-ramp program, come complete the daily WOD in these classes!

Personal Training

Maybe you're looking to improve your fitness, rehab an injury, or fine tune your movements. Or maybe you're just not interested in working out in a group setting. Schedule a one-on-one with one of our coaches!

Corporate Wellness

Do you want your employees to be healthy, happy, and productive? Our customizable, comprehensive corporate wellness program will help keep your employees disease and injury free.


Our yoga classes are designed especially for CrossFitters, and are targeted to areas in the body that you've worked hard in the programmed WODs during the week.

Humanity Barbell

If you're looking to follow a powerlifting or olympic weightlifting program, and/or to compete in either of these disciplines, Humanity Barbell is the place for you!


If you need guidance with nutrition, you've come to the right place. We'll work with you to fine-tune your diet to your needs.

Olympic Weightlifting

Whether you're new to olympic weightlifting or just want to improve your technique, efficiency, and coordination, we've got you covered! You'll perform the snatch and clean and jerk, as well as dynamic pulling and squat drills.


If you're new, we want to ensure you're introduced to CrossFit in a safe and effective manner. On-ramp will help you learn the all the skills you need to participate in group CrossFit classes.

Open Gym

You want to get your workout in, but you don't need a group class or one-on-one session. Come on in to open gym to work on your skills, do a workout, stretch, mobilize, or even socialize!


No gymnastics experience is necessary to have fun in this class! Work on your hollow rocks, muscle ups, handstands, ring dips, and more!


Most of us know we need to work on our mobility to improve our quality of movement and decrease the probability of injury. Actually doing this, however, is often another story. If you're not one to sit down on your own to get your mobility in, come on in and do it with a group!

CrossFit Conditioning

If you're looking to complement your strength training with some good old fashioned cardiovascular conditioning, look no further. You'll run, you'll row, you'll work on your agility, and you'll keep your body constantly adapting to everything you throw at it!